Your Committee on Ways and Means, to which was referred S.B. No. 971, S.D. 1, entitled:
"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O EMERGENCY MEDICAL SERVICES,"
begs leave to report as follows:
The purpose and intent of this measure is to change the means of funding for the statewide emergency medical system.
More specifically, the measure:
(1) Repeals the emergency medical services special fund;
(2) Redirects the fund's revenue sources to the general fund; and
(3) Appropriates general funds to support the statewide emergency medical system.
Your Committee received written comments in support of this measure from Hana Health.
Your Committee finds that anti-smoking campaigns have contributed to the decline in cigarette use in Hawaii. The decline in cigarette purchases, however, has also led to a decline in cigarette tax revenues and associated deposits to the emergency medical services special fund. Your Committee believes that repealing the emergency medical services special fund, redirecting the fund's revenue sources to the general fund, and making general fund appropriations for the programs funded by the emergency medical services special fund will promote more prudent budgeting of emergency medical system expenses and provide a more stable means of funding.
Your Committee has amended this measure by:
(1) Changing the amount appropriated for the statewide comprehensive emergency medical services system for fiscal years 2017-2018 and 2018-2019 from $14,796,503 to an unspecified sum; and
(2) Changing the effective date to July 1, 2050, to facilitate further discussion on the measure.
As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Ways and Means that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of S.B. No. 971, S.D. 1, as amended herein, and recommends that it pass Third Reading in the form attached hereto as S.B. No. 971, S.D. 2.
